The Women’s Premier League (WPL) 2024 has been an exhilarating journey for fans, showcasing outstanding cricketing skills and creating memorable moments on and off the field. One such unforgettable episode unfolded recently in the Mumbai Indians camp, as the team came together to celebrate their skipper Harmanpreet Kaur‘s 35th birthday with flair and enthusiasm. The festivities took place after Mumbai Indians secured a convincing victory over the UP Warriorz at the Arun Jaitley Stadium.

Defending champions continue their stellar run

Mumbai Indians, the inaugural edition winners, have once again displayed their prowess in the ongoing tournament and are on the verge of confirming their spot in the playoffs. Under the captaincy of the revered Harmanpreet, the team has flourished, and the birthday celebration served as a testament to the camaraderie and respect shared among the players.

Teammates unite to make Harmanpreet Kaur’s birthday special

Harmanpreet, an iconic figure in Indian cricket, has earned immense respect in the cricketing world, and her leadership in the Women’s Premier League has further solidified her legacy. The special birthday celebration organized by her teammates showcased the deep bond they share, making the occasion truly memorable.

Messages, Cake smash, and Punjabi beats: A perfect birthday celebration

The official Twitter handle of Mumbai Indians gave fans a glimpse of the heartwarming celebration, featuring a video compilation of the team’s adorable messages, a cake-smashing ceremony, and an impromptu dance session to Punjabi tunes.

The messages from teammates were diverse, reflecting their unique styles and admiration for their skipper, creating an emotional and joyful atmosphere as Harmanpreet watched all the wishes. Harmanpreet even showcased a different side on the special occasion as she joined forces with her former India teammate Jhulan Goswami in a spirited dance. The duo’s infectious energy added an extra layer of joy to the celebration, leaving fans delighted and inspired.

The video quickly went viral on the internet, capturing the attention of fans who reveled in the festive spirit radiating from the Mumbai Indians camp.
